I've been trying to edit the mesh of the kotatsu table that came with Snowy escape to be a low table more appropriate for warmer weather. It was easy enough to remove the quilt and make some table legs for it, (jk it was pulling teeth--this is my first bb cc) I tried it out in-game and it works! sorta... The way the table works in the game is an animated blanket panel spawns over the sim's legs as they slide under--the actual table doesn't animate at all. So while the table looks alright at first, once the sim tries to sit at it they get a lap blanket. I'd hoped that removing the blanket pattern from the texture map and replacing it with a blank transparent space would fix it, since the phantom blanket sources from the same texture to match it. No dice. I can't tell if it's something I could modify in S4Studio or if it's a coding thing. Even if I did have a way to look at the code, I wouldn't know what to look for or what to do with it.
